Embodiment 1
[0045] A method for automatic switching of multiple types of charts, comprising the following steps:
[0046] S1. Extract the respective parameters of various 2.5D charts that need to be switched;
[0047] S2. Divide the parameters extracted in step S1 into common parameters and difference parameters;
[0048] S3. Encapsulate the public parameter part as a public module;
[0049] S4. Encapsulate the difference parameter part as a difference module, and the difference module corresponds to the type of chart one by one;
[0050] S5. Encapsulate the difference module and the common module into one UE component, and configure switching options for the UE component.
[0051]This solution uses the above method to integrate multiple 2.5D charts into one UE component, divide the parameters of multiple 2.5D charts into common parameters and differential parameters, and include a set of common parameter configurations and multiple sets of differential parameters in UE building Config...
Embodiment 2
[0053] The difference between this embodiment and Embodiment 1 is that the 2.5D chart includes at least two types of 2.5D pie chart, 2.5D ring chart, 2.5D rose chart, 2.5D columnar ring chart, and 2.5D fan-shaped ring chart.
[0054] Further, the public parameters include at least one of general configuration, prompt box, legend, and data label.
[0055] Further, the difference parameter includes at least one of visual style, inner radius size, outer radius size, ring block gap, and ring block thickness.
Embodiment 3
[0057] The difference between this embodiment and Embodiment 2 is that the step S4 encapsulates the difference parameter part as a difference module, and after the difference module corresponds to the chart type one by one, it also includes establishing the relationship between the parameters in each difference module.
[0058] Further, the relationship of parameters in each difference module includes at least one of a size relationship and a position relationship.
[0059] Since 2.5D charts are mainly used for data visualization display, try to ensure that the position and size of the chart do not change much when switching charts, otherwise you need to adjust other components of the data visualization interface, and set the size between parameters in the difference module The relationship with the position is to set the relationship between the size and position of the corresponding 2.5D charts, so that the controllability of chart switching is higher.
